488 nm Blue Low Noise Collimated Diode Laser SystemThe LLD-0488 Series of Low-Noise Collimated Diode Lasers are ideal for applications requiring less than 0.2% noise and output power levels from 5 mW to 150 mW. These 488 nm lasers maintain a high level of long-term output power stability and long operating lifetime at an aggressively competitive cost. These lasers are commonly used for fluorescence excitation, PIV, Raman Spectroscopy, and a broad spectrum of other applications. The driver is available as a complete FDA-compliant system or as an O.E.M. component with significantly reduced dimensions. At Sherline, we manufacture the world's most complete line of precision milling machines, lathes, and chucker lathes (also known as Mini or Micro Mills and Lathes). We manufacture both manual and CNC machines for benchtop or tabletop-size workspaces, along with a full line of accessories to support these machines.
